阿拓莫兰对体外循环患者中性粒细胞激活干预作用的临床研究

摘    要:目的 观察阿拓莫兰对临床体外循环患儿中性粒细胞激活的干预作用。方法 随机抽取年龄 6~ 12岁先天性心脏病患儿 2 0例 ,单盲法配对分组为对照组 10例、干预组 10例 ,干预组体外循环预充液中加入阿拓莫兰 30mg/kg ,分别于术前 2 4h、体外循环开始 2 0min、复温前、体外循环结束前、术后 4h、术后 2 4h抽取静脉血 ,分离中性粒细胞 ,提取核蛋白 ,以电泳迁移率实验测定核转录因子κB活性变化 ;免疫组化检测细胞间粘附分子 (ICAM 1)的表达。结果 对照组体外循环开始 2 0min后 ,中性粒细胞核转录因子κB已被激活 ,在复温前达到峰值 ,术后 2 4h逐渐恢复至 (0 13± 0 0 4 ) (×10 6)术前水平 ;复温前ICAM 1开始表达增加 ,术后 4h达到峰值 ,术后 2 4h逐渐恢复至 (0 2 0± 0 0 9)(× 10 6)术前水平。干预组二者表达均下降 ,核转录因子κB活性于术后 4h下降为 0 12± 0 0 3(×10 6) ,ICAM 1于术后 4h下降为 2 5 2± 0 96 (× 10 6)与同时间点对照组 4 2 0± 0 82 (× 10 6)比较差异有显著意义 (P <0 0 5 )。结论 体外循环过程可激活中性粒细胞 ,中性粒细胞核转录因子κB活化 ,ICAM 1表达增强 ;阿拓莫兰可抑制中性粒细胞激活 ,减轻全身炎性反应。

The intervention of reduced glutathione in neutrophil activation in the process of extracorporeal circulation

Abstract:OBJECTIVE: To study the intervention of reduced glutathione for neutrophil activation in the process of extracorporeal circulation. METHOD: 20 congenital heart disease children aged from 6 to 12 years were selected randomly, divided into control group and interventional group, patients of interventional group were added reduced glutathione (30 mg/kg) in priming fluid, then phlebotomized on the time of 24 hours before operation, 20 minutes after CPB, rewarming, the end of CPB, 4 hours after operation, 24 hours after operation. After separated neutrophil, we distilled nuclear protein and mensurated the activation of nuclear factor-kappaB by EMSA, assayed the expression of ICAM-1. by immunohistochemistry. RESULTS: Neutrophil nuclear factor-kappaB has been activated on the time of 20 minutes after CPB, arrives at the top on the time of rewarming, and resumes 24 hours after operation; ICAM-1 expresses on the time of rewarming, arrives at the top 4 hours after operation in control group. The data of interventional group is lower than the control group. CONCLUSION: Neutrophil nuclear factor-kappaB is activated and ICAM-1 is expressed in the process of extracorporeal circulation and play an important role in the inflammatory response happening in extracorporeal circulation, which could be relieved by reduced glutathione.
